An overly worn brake pad is indicated on the display screen by a service notification and a yellow warning level malfunction alert. Danger. The braking characteristics of the bus may change if a yellow warning level malfunction relating to brake system is shown on the display screen. Adopt a particularly cautious driving style. Have the malfunction rectified as soon as possible by an EvoBus Service Partner.
